    Le'Veon Bell isn't carrying this team? Has anyone actually watched the Steelers this year? Bell is on an entirely different level than pretty much any other back in the NFL.

    Bell hits the hole better than any other back in the NFL right now and it's not even close. Yes, Marshawn breaks a lot of tackles and runs hard, but Bell just decisively hits the correct hole more often than not and he doesn't take a lot of big shots. He's a smart and patient runner with elite size and outstanding speed/burst.

    Roethlisberger wouldn't be having the season he is having without Bell.
    77 receptions and 3 receiving TDs.
